Images That Sell

We’ve all heard the saying, “A picture is worth a thousand words.” Perhaps the most valuable tool for moving a vehicle quickly is the photographs in the listing. When searching for that perfect car or truck, it’s the photos that are going to draw interested buyers into a listing. Moreover, high quality photos also have the potential to move the vehicle for hundreds or thousands more in cash value.

Photos should be taken with the best camera available, ideally a digital camera capable of shooting at least 7mp images. Both the interior and exterior of the vehicle should be cleaned thoroughly before being photographed. Giving your used vehicle a new look by cleaning it before the photos are taken will go a long way toward a higher cash value at the time of sale.

Have a clear idea of which areas of the vehicle you wish to photograph. An OSM ad package allows you to upload 12 vehicle photos per listing. 12 Photos are easily enough to give an overall treatment of the vehicle. Here is a simple list of suggested photo regions for a standard 4-door car or truck:

Exterior:

  • Front
  • Rear
  • Passenger Side
  • Driver Side
  • Tire Close-up

Interior:

  • Front Seats (From Driver Door)
  • Front Seats (From Passenger Door)
  • Back Seats (From Driver Side)
  • Back Seats (From Passenger Side)
  • Dashboard
  • Odometer Close Up
  • VIN Close up

As you can see, these 12 photos provide more than enough detail to wet the appetites of potential buyers. Extra photos should also be taken and kept on hand. While they may not appear in the listing itself, buyers often request additional photos before opting to purchase. Some good areas for these extra shots are “under the hood” photos, photos of the exhaust, as well as any major dents or problem areas.

Choosing the right location for photographing your vehicle is also an important consideration. Ideally, the location should be simple, drawing attention to the vehicle. Well maintained driveways and curbsides are good choices. If possible avoid locations with excessive clutter, or with ill maintained structures in the background. Try and take the photos under clear weather conditions, at around the middle of the day. This will make for higher quality photos with sharper detail.

Taking the time and effort to include clear, bright, high quality photos in your listing is possibly the single most effective tool to increase the effectiveness of your vehicle’s marketing campaign.

Honda fuel-cell vehicle planned for Southern CA

Honda plans to lease their new fuel-cell-powered concept car to the general public. The new FCX will be available to consumers in Southern California in limited quantities beginning in the summer of 2008.

The FCX is a Zero Emissions Vehicle (ZEV); and will be certified by the EPA as a Tier-2 Bin 1, which is the lowest possible EPA emissions rating. Honda has stated that the vehicle is twice as fuel-efficient as a hybrid, and three times more than a conventional gas fueled vehicle.

The Honda FCX Clarity

The FCX can travel approximately 270 miles before needing to refuel at one of several hydrogen fuel stations in the Southern California region. Honda is also currently developing a “Home Energy Station” which will supply energy to the home while refueling the car right inside the garage.
